summ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orDimitris Kiziridis2020-07-09 02:48:45 +0300
committerDimitris Kiziridis2020-07-09 02:48:45 +0300
commitee42fa479ae5039bd0746a97b0deb98ca0de2479 (patch)
tree6c284d17d70ae1d80cdc672f9a500111cc980356
parent6fbb514e20dff72a490de80a2808825a16e3bddd (diff)
downloadaur-ee42fa479ae5039bd0746a97b0deb98ca0de2479.tar.gz
pkgbuild rewrite
-rw-r--r--.SRCINFO13
-rw-r--r--PKGBUILD52
-rw-r--r--oblogout.install10
3 files changed, 33 insertions, 42 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 2659879e249b..6ab929a9d9f6 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,15 +1,14 @@
-# Generated by mksrcinfo v8
-# Sun Nov 5 10:24:10 UTC 2017
pkgbase = oblogout-fork-git
- pkgdesc = Openbox Logout Script Fork used by CrunchBang
+ pkgdesc = GTK/Cairo based logout box styled for Crunchbang
pkgver = 20130106
- pkgrel = 3
+ pkgrel = 4
url = https://github.com/Cloudef/oblogout-fork
install = oblogout.install
arch = any
license = GPL2
makedepends = git
depends = pygtk
+ depends = python
depends = python2-pillow
depends = python2-distutils-extra
depends = python2-dbus
@@ -17,10 +16,12 @@ pkgbase = oblogout-fork-git
conflicts = openboxlogout-gnome
conflicts = oblogout
backup = etc/oblogout.conf
+ source = oblogout-fork::git+https://github.com/Cloudef/oblogout-fork
source = oblogout.conf
source = switch-user.patch
- md5sums = 1e43b3a6ffeaefa0f68152a473259676
- md5sums = 86a7a64ae86c0d733f69d37da05eb357
+ sha256sums = SKIP
+ sha256sums = SKIP
+ sha256sums = SKIP
pkgname = oblogout-fork-git
diff --git a/PKGBUILD b/PKGBUILD
index 7fb439ebfdcc..b3e568bfbab5 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,46 +1,38 @@
-# Maintainer: dustball
+# Maintainer: Dimitris Kiziridis <ragouel at outlook dot com>
+# Contributor: dustball
pkgname=oblogout-fork-git
pkgver=20130106
-pkgrel=3
-pkgdesc="Openbox Logout Script Fork used by CrunchBang"
+pkgrel=4
+pkgdesc="GTK/Cairo based logout box styled for Crunchbang"
arch=('any')
-url="https://github.com/Cloudef/oblogout-fork"
-depends=('pygtk' 'python2-pillow' 'python2-distutils-extra' 'python2-dbus')
+url='https://github.com/Cloudef/oblogout-fork'
+license=('GPL2')
+depends=('pygtk'
+ 'python'
+ 'python2-pillow'
+ 'python2-distutils-extra'
+ 'python2-dbus')
optdepends=('upower')
makedepends=('git')
-license=('GPL2')
backup=(etc/oblogout.conf)
conflicts=('openboxlogout-gnome' 'oblogout')
install=oblogout.install
-source=(oblogout.conf
- switch-user.patch)
-md5sums=('1e43b3a6ffeaefa0f68152a473259676'
- '86a7a64ae86c0d733f69d37da05eb357')
-
-_gitroot="git://github.com/Cloudef/oblogout-fork.git"
-_gitname="oblogout-fork"
+source=("${pkgname%-git}::git+${url}"
+ 'oblogout.conf'
+ 'switch-user.patch')
+sha256sums=('SKIP'
+ 'SKIP'
+ 'SKIP')
build() {
- cd "$srcdir"
- msg "Connecting to GIT server...."
-
- if [ -d $_gitname ] ; then
- cd $_gitname && git pull origin
- msg "The local files are updated."
- else
- git clone $_gitroot $_gitname --dept=1
- fi
-
- cd "$srcdir/$_gitname"
-
+ cd "${pkgname%-git}"
patch -p1 < "$srcdir/switch-user.patch"
}
package() {
- cd "$srcdir/$_gitname"
- python2 setup.py install --root="$pkgdir/"
- install -m644 "$srcdir/oblogout.conf" "$pkgdir/etc/"
+ cd "${pkgname%-git}"
+ python2 setup.py install --root="${pkgdir}/"
+ install -m644 "${srcdir}/oblogout.conf" "${pkgdir}/etc/"
}
-
-# vim:set ts=2 sw=2 et:
+# vim:set ts=2 sw=2 et: \ No newline at end of file
diff --git a/oblogout.install b/oblogout.install
index 6aaed9150454..5e72d593f5ca 100644
--- a/oblogout.install
+++ b/oblogout.install
@@ -1,14 +1,12 @@
post_install () {
-
-echo ' IMPORTANT'
-echo 'Make sure that dbus is running'
-echo 'Customise the config (/etc/oblogout.conf) as required'
+ echo ' IMPORTANT'
+ echo 'Make sure that dbus is running'
+ echo 'Customise the config (/etc/oblogout.conf) as required'
}
post_upgrade() {
post_install $1
}
-
op=$1
shift
-$op $*
+$op $* \ No newline at end of file